About the Role:
The Revenue Operations Analyst will play a vital role in the advancement of Upgrade. Reporting to the Chief of Staff, the Revenue Operations Analyst is responsible for analyzing data trends, coordinating people and processes to ensure projects are delivered on time, and ensuring metrics are in place to measure implemented programs. You will be the go to person for everything involving Home Improvement’s product organization and timelines.
What You’ll Do:
Analyze revenue data to detect trends to help drive revenue decision making within the organization
Develop detailed project plans on behalf of the Sales, CS, and Operations teams
Ensure resource availability so that projects are delivered on time, within budget, and on scope
Coordinate internal resources and, if necessary, third parties vendors for execution of projects
Use appropriate verification techniques to manage changes in project scope, schedule, and costs
Develop KPIs and measure project performance using appropriate systems, tools, and techniques
Create and maintain comprehensive project and process documentation
Help the maintenance of the data in the CRM to ensure accuracy of reporting
What We Look For:
BA/BS degree preferred or equivalent experience in similar role
2+ years revenue operations or project management experience; preferably in a similar industry or a SaaS organization
Solid technical background with a focused knowledge of SQL, Tableau, and Microsoft Office Products
Familiarity with software such as Smartsheet, Salesforce, and Outreach
PMP/PRINCE 2 certification preferred
Excellent written and verbal skills
Owner attitude, self starter, comfortable operating independently
Flexibility to prioritize, balance and respond to competing needs within a growing organization
Experience operating in a fast-paced environment and comfortable prioritizing critical issues
